Researching Flight Deals
When looking for the cheapest flight deals, it is essential to do thorough research to find the best prices. Utilizing flight comparison websites, setting up price alerts, and being flexible with your travel dates are key strategies to help you save money on your next trip.
Using Flight Comparison Websites
- Compare prices across multiple websites like Skyscanner, Google Flights, and Kayak to find the best deals.
- Use filters to narrow down your search by airline, layovers, and departure times for more tailored results.
- Sign up for alerts on these websites to be notified when prices drop for specific routes.
Setting Up Price Alerts
- Set up price alerts on various platforms to monitor fare changes and take advantage of lower prices when they become available.
- Enter your desired route and travel dates to receive notifications when prices fluctuate.
- Be ready to book quickly when you receive an alert for a price drop to secure the best deal.
Benefits of Flexible Travel Dates
- Being flexible with your travel dates can help you find cheaper flights, as prices often vary depending on the day of the week and time of year.
- Consider flying mid-week or during off-peak seasons to access lower fares and avoid peak travel times.
- Use fare calendars on flight comparison websites to identify the cheapest days to fly and adjust your dates accordingly.
Booking Strategies
Booking flights can be a tricky task, especially when trying to find the best deals. Here are some strategies to consider when booking your next flight:
Advantages of Booking in Advance vs. Last-Minute Deals
When it comes to booking flights, there are advantages to both booking in advance and waiting for last-minute deals. Booking in advance often allows you to secure lower prices, as airlines tend to increase fares as the departure date approaches. On the other hand, last-minute deals can sometimes offer significant discounts on unsold seats. However, these deals are unpredictable and may not always be available for the destination or dates you desire.
Best Days of the Week to Book Flights
Research shows that the best days to book flights for lower prices are usually Tuesdays and Wednesdays. Airlines often release deals and discounts mid-week, making it a prime time to secure cheaper fares. Additionally, booking flights for mid-week travel, rather than weekends, can also help save money on your next trip.
Impact of Layovers and Connecting Flights
Layovers and connecting flights can play a significant role in finding cheaper deals. Opting for flights with layovers or connections can often result in lower fares compared to non-stop flights. However, it’s essential to consider the duration of layovers and the overall travel time, as longer layovers may not be worth the savings. Additionally, connecting flights can sometimes lead to delays or missed connections, so weigh the pros and cons before booking your next flight.
Utilizing Frequent Flyer Programs
Utilizing frequent flyer programs can be a great way to secure discounted flights and maximize the benefits of airline loyalty programs. By earning and redeeming miles, you can significantly reduce the cost of your flights and even enjoy additional perks like priority boarding and upgrades.
Earning Miles
- Sign up for frequent flyer programs with airlines you frequently use.
- Utilize co-branded credit cards to earn miles on everyday purchases.
- Take advantage of promotional offers and bonuses for earning extra miles.
Redeeming Miles
- Check for available award flights and plan your trips accordingly to maximize mileage redemption.
- Be flexible with your travel dates to increase the chances of finding flights that can be booked with miles.
- Consider using miles for upgrades or other benefits to get the most value out of your rewards.
Maximizing Benefits
- Stay informed about changes to the program rules and take advantage of any new opportunities to earn or redeem miles.
- Combine miles from different sources, such as flights, credit cards, and partners, to reach redemption thresholds faster.
- Utilize elite status perks to enjoy priority treatment and access to exclusive deals and discounts.
Alternative Airports and Routes
When looking for the cheapest flight deals, considering alternative airports and routes can significantly impact the cost of your journey. By being flexible with your departure and arrival locations, you open up a world of possibilities to save money on flights.
Flying to Alternative Airports
When booking your flight, keep in mind that flying to alternative airports can often result in significant cost savings. Instead of choosing the main airport in a city, explore nearby airports that may offer cheaper flights. For example, if you are traveling to London, consider flying into Gatwick or Stansted instead of Heathrow to potentially find better deals.
- Research different airports in the vicinity of your destination to compare prices.
- Check for transportation options from alternative airports to your final destination to ensure convenience.
- Be open to exploring airports in neighboring cities for additional cost-saving opportunities.
Choosing Indirect Routes
Opting for indirect routes with layovers or connecting flights can sometimes lead to more affordable flight options. While direct flights may be more convenient, they often come with a higher price tag. By considering flights with stops along the way, you may discover hidden deals that could significantly reduce your overall travel expenses.
Keep in mind that choosing indirect routes may result in longer travel times, so weigh the cost savings against the potential inconvenience.
- Use flight search engines to compare prices for direct and indirect routes to find the best deal.
- Consider booking separate tickets for each leg of your journey to potentially save money.
- Stay flexible with your travel dates to increase the chances of finding cheaper indirect routes.
